How to Make Broccoli and Cheese Casserole
PREP. Preheat oven to 350 °F and prep a 9×13 inch baking dish with cooking spray or butter.
FILLING. Mix together the condensed soup, mayonnaise, and egg in a medium sized mixing bowl. Place all three packages of broccoli into a large bowl (I like to use my large stainless steel bowl to mix this recipe thoroughly). Be sure to beak up the frozen broccoli florets. Next, use a rubber spatula to empty the mayo mixture on top of the broccoli. Mix well. Add the cheese and mix again.
(If you are adding the chicken, mix it in now)
TOPPING. Transfer the broccoli mixture to the 9×13 baking dish. Use the rubber spatula to smooth the top and then season with garlic salt and pepper. In a Ziploc bag mix together the butter and crackers and sprinkle over the top of the casserole.
BAKE. Bake for 45-50 minutes.
Variation Ideas
Here are a few ways to change this up…
- Add 1-2 c cooked white rice to the broccoli mixture
- Add 1-2 c cooked shredded or cubed chicken to the broccoli mixture
- Substitute the broccoli with cauliflower
- Panko crumbs with extra butter can be used in place of the ritz crackers
- Add sliced mushrooms
- Add diced onions or scallions
- Use fresh broccoli florets (blanched)
Storing tips + side ideas
Can you make this ahead of time? Yes! Assemble all but the Ritz crackers. Cover and store in the fridge for 1-2 days. To prep for the freezer wrap with plastic wrap then again with aluminum foil. Label and fre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w if frozen, add the ritz crackers and bake uncovered according to the recipe directions.
How to store leftovers? Divide leftovers into individual serving size containers. Store in the fridge for up to 3 days or in the freezer for 1-2 months. Heat in the microwave or even on the stove top.

- 1- 10.75 oz can condensed cream of mushroom soup
- 1/2 c mayonnaise
- 1/2 c sour cream
- 1 egg beaten
- 3- 10 oz packages frozen broccoli chopped
- 12 oz sharp cheddar cheese shredded
- 20 Ritz crackers crushed
- 2 tbsp butter melted
- 2 c shredded chicken optional
